Edward Schairer Obituary

Edward "Ed" Matthew Schairer, 78, of Middletown, Maryland, passed from this life on Thursday, May 2, 2024 at Spring Arbor of Frederick in Frederick, MD. He was the loving husband of Sarah "Sally" Staley Schairer for 35 years.

Born on February 6, 1946, in Cambridge, MA, he was the son of the late Edward Vincent Schairer and Helen (Abucewich) Schairer.

He was a graduate of St. Mary's High School, 1963, and Massachusetts College of Pharmacy, 1968. He served in Vietnam from 1968-69, and completed his tour of duty at Ft. Detrick.

Ed was a pharmacist at Weis Markets for 28 years. Additionally, he was an avid fan of the Boston Red Sox and New England Patriots.

Ed was loved by all and will be greatly missed.

In addition to his wife, he is survived by children, Casey Schairer-Flores (William), and Aaron Wachter (Katie); grandchildren, Oliver Flores, Molly and Logan Wachter, and Chance and Keelin Dove; siblings, Vincent Schairer (Monique), and Josephine Schairer; and many nieces and nephews.

He was predeceased by daughters, Amy Dove and Lydia Schairer, and an infant grandson, Christopher.
